Обновление приложения новым сертификатом - PullRequest
2 голосов
/ 07 июня 2011

Короче говоря: я разработал приложение для компании, и я собирался обновить, когда обнаружил, что в области центра участников на веб-сайте Apple пропал Сертификат разработки, а также устройства и другие материал, поэтому я сделал новый и загрузил идентификатор устройства снова.

Так что все в порядке ... Я думал. Я открыл iTunes, загрузил новый профиль обеспечения и перетащил его в окно органайзера. Но это не сработало. Я получил несколько разных предупреждений и ошибок о том, что ключи, сертификаты и т. Д. Не совпадают, поэтому я погуглил. Я видел сообщения, в которых говорилось: попробуйте создать новый сертификат распространения ... так я и сделал, затем xcode сказал мне, что мне нужно много сертификатов для этого приложения, поэтому я экспортировал сертификаты, щелкнув правой кнопкой мыши выбранные сертификаты в цепочке для ключей и коснувшись экспорта , Я получил файл Certificates.cer. Затем я удалил эти сертификаты, чтобы освободить место для новых, загруженных с портала центра участников.

ТАК, теперь я не знаю, что я сделал ... Боюсь, что я что-то напортачил.

У меня такой вопрос: я действительно надеюсь, что все еще можно обновить приложение, уже находящееся в магазине приложений, хотя мне нужно заново создать сертификаты, профили обеспечения и т. Д.

С наилучшими пожеланиями

1 Ответ

1 голос
/ 07 июня 2011

Вы всегда можете начать с нуля, удалив все профили инициализации через свою страницу участника для разработчиков, воссоздав нужные профили, импортировав их в Xcode и восстановив приложение с ними. Вы не можете так много испортить, не имея возможности снова опубликовать приложение.

Очистите все содержимое Xcode и страницы ваших профилей инициализации и начните заново. Вещи будут работать. Я делал это десятки раз.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...